Russia's war against Ukraine has ramifications for the chips that power all sorts of tech. Ukraine is the world's biggest exporter of Neon, a gas that plays a fundamental role in controlling the specialised lasers manufacturers use to make computer chips. These companies have been stockpiling since 2014, preparing for a significant disruption like the one it unfolded when the war started. But reserves are now running out fast, and very few alternatives in the supply chain currently exist to the gas. Rebecca Heilweil explores the looming crisis.
